Theoretical fiction can expand our minds. It often presents new concepts, ideas, and ways of thinking. For example, in some science - fictional theoretical fictions, they might explore future societies or advanced technologies that we haven't even dreamed of yet. It allows authors to play with different theories and show their potential implications in fictional settings.
The significance lies in its ability to stimulate intellectual curiosity. Theoretical fiction can take a scientific or philosophical theory and make it accessible through storytelling. It's like a bridge between complex ideas and the general public. By creating fictional scenarios based on theories, it encourages readers to think more deeply about those theories and how they could impact our world or other possible worlds.

Past fiction often serves as a window into different eras. It can show the values, beliefs, and social structures of the past. For example, classic novels like 'Pride and Prejudice' by Jane Austen give us a vivid picture of the social norms and class distinctions in 19th - century England. It allows us to understand how people interacted, courted, and dealt with family and society at that time.
